Spotting the Trouble: Signs of Droopiness

🚩 Visual Clues

Droopy leaves on a Golden Mosaic Plant scream "help!" Visual cues are your first hint that something's off. Leaves that once stood proud may now hang their heads in defeat. They might feel limp, look less vibrant, and lack their usual perkiness.

🕰 When to Worry

Not all droop is a disaster. Some natural sagging occurs as leaves age. But when your plant's posture goes from a casual slouch to a full-on flop, it's time for action. Yellowing, browning, or a sudden increase in leaf drop are your plant's way of waving a white flag.

Getting to the Root: Unearthing Causes

💧 Water Woes: Too Much or Too Little

Overwatering turns your Golden Mosaic Plant's roots into a swampy mess, while underwatering leaves them thirstier than a marathon runner. The droop is a cry for help; it's time to reassess your watering game.

Adjust your watering to the plant's lifestyle—think of it as a seasonal drinker, with a hearty gulp in summer and a modest sip in winter.

🌡️ Climate Culprits: Light and Temperature

Light and temperature can make or break your plant's posture. Too much heat and light, and your plant wilts like it's in a desert; too little, and it's reaching for the sun like a lost soul.

  • Lopsided growth? Rotate your plant for even light exposure.
  • Yellowing leaves? It's either too much love or not enough.

Keep an eye on the thermostat and the blinds. Your plant's comfort zone is a cozy nook with bright, indirect sunlight and a steady temperature—no sudden chills or heatwaves, please.

Bouncing Back: Revival Tactics

💧 Fine-Tuning Watering Habits

Balancing soil moisture is crucial for your Golden Mosaic Plant's comeback. Overwatering is the silent killer, while underwatering is the slow torture. Check the soil before you water—think of it as the plant's pulse.

The Art of Watering

Watering is less about routine and more about response. Use the soak and dry method: water thoroughly, then wait until the top inch of soil is dry before watering again. This encourages roots to seek moisture and grow stronger.

🌞 Creating the Perfect Ambiance

Light and temperature can make or break your plant's spirit. Bright, indirect light is the sweet spot for the Golden Mosaic Plant. Direct sunlight? That's a harsh no. It's like putting an ice cream cone in the sun—meltdown city.

🌡️ Temperature and Light Harmony

Keep the temperature consistent, avoiding drafts and sudden changes. Think of your plant as a guest at a party—it wants to be comfortable, not shivering in the corner or sweating on the dance floor.

🍃 The Ideal Home

A well-draining pot and soil mix are non-negotiable. Add perlite or vermiculite to the mix to ensure proper drainage. It's like a good mattress for your plant—supportive but not suffocating.

Remember, monitoring is key. Watch for signs of improvement and adjust care accordingly. Your plant's not just surviving; it's trying to thrive. Give it the care it craves, and it'll reward you with a dazzling display.

Keeping It Up: Prevention Strategies

💧 Consistency is Key

Establishing a routine is like signing a peace treaty with your Golden Mosaic Plant. It thrives on predictability. Watering at regular intervals, consistent light exposure, and stable temperatures are the trifecta of care that keeps droopiness at bay. Keep a watchful eye for signs of distress, and be ready to adjust your care tactics with the finesse of a plant diplomat.

🌱 The Right Setup from the Start

Choosing the correct pot and soil mix can be as crucial as picking a life partner for your plant. Go for well-draining soil and a home with drainage holes to prevent soggy feet. Acclimatization is not just a fancy word; it's a critical process. Introduce your plant to new environments or routines with the gentleness of a sloth moving to a new tree. This isn't just about preventing droopiness; it's about fostering a lush, upright life for your leafy friend.
